Hoti at the European Parliament asked about Kurti's ouster from power, talks with Haradinaj

Prime Minister Avdullah Hoti is answering the questions of European Parliament deputies in Brussels. He's been asked if he can stay in the power he's taken “from the election winner”. The EP's Kosovo NGO, Violet von Cremen, was gentle in her questions to the prime minister, even though she has been a supporter of Albin Kurti's government.
She asked the prime minister only because the European Integration Ministry has disappeared.
Another Eurodeput asked Hoti questions about foreign policy. He told the prime minister that he has taken power from the election winner and asked whether the government Hoti can survive without going to the polls. ,
You came to power by taking it from the election winner, which has caused much frustration there. How would you stay in power if you came to power in this form? ”, asked the eurodeputet, broadcast Express.
Meanwhile, Hoti, when answering a series of questions together, also stopped at what he called the internal “polic”.
Hoti said there is no reason for new elections in Kosovo and that he leads a governing coalition with the majority of the Parliament's votes.
“As far as domestic politics is concerned, I see no reason for new elections. We're a majority coalition of the Parliament. We as well as any coalition have internal issues, but I see no reason for this coalition not to continue. We are committed to a final solution with Serbia. I'm asking you to support us in this process”, Hoti said, broadcast Express.
